The experiment assigns dynamic price multipliers per session, and the guardrail monitor has flagged a cohort receiving multipliers outside the approved 0.8–1.3 range. Because pricing assignment touches session tokens and the experiment bucketing service, a security reviewer should confirm no assignment tampering occurred before the experiment is resumed. Cohort definitions, guardrail thresholds, and the audit log query are documented on the internal page below.

operations page: https://confluence.qorvellabs.internal/pages/projects/projects/projects

## Ticket: Sort order drifting in Reportsmith builder

Hey plugin folks — we've noticed that reports built against the Reportsmith sandbox sort ties differently than production. Turns out the two environments drifted: sandbox picked up a stable-sort patch that prod hasn't, so plugins relying on tie order will see flips after the next release. Please switch to explicit secondary sort keys now rather than later. For reference, the sandbox builder currently runs with these settings.

service settings:
[casax]
port = 6379
team = rusir
host = casax.zemvarhq.corp
region = outer-4
access_code = ac_9808ce
timeout_ms = 1500

So the Skylark-3 unit from the Penhollow site is back for servicing again. Quick steps: power it down fully, pop the battery into the fireproof pouch, and pack the airframe in the orange case with the propellers removed (they snap off — don't force them). Tape the service slip to the lid, not inside. Tethermoor Repairs sends their own courier, usually mid-afternoon on Wednesdays. Keep the case at reception until then, not in the back room. When the courier signs the intake form, relay this one instruction:

handover note for kagep-kagup: the holok holdor courier leaves the rusix sorox fenwyn ledger at gate 3590 under passcode 092644